Where to stay in Tokyo

Find the best Tokyo areas and neighborhoods for the activities you enjoy most. Learn more about Tokyo
Learn more about Tokyo

Shinjuku

Major commercial hub with the bustling Shinjuku Station, Tokyo Metropolitan Government Building, and various attractions like Kabukichō, Golden Gai, and Shinjuku Gyoen. Shop at flagship stores and enjoy diverse dining options.

Shibuya

Major commercial and finance hub, Shibuya boasts bustling railway stations, trendy fashion scenes in Harajuku and Omotesandō, and vibrant nightlife. Don't miss the iconic Shibuya Crossing and Hachikō statue.

Ginza

Upscale shopping and luxurious dining await in this elegant district, featuring flagship fashion stores, art galleries, and the renowned Sukiyabashi Jiro sushi restaurant. Catch a kabuki performance at Kabuki-za theater or stroll through pedestrian heaven on weekends.

Asakusa

Discover Sensō-ji, a renowned Buddhist temple, and savor traditional Japanese cuisine at local eateries. Explore Kappabashi-dori for kitchenware, cruise the Sumida River, and stay in a cozy ryokan near the Tokyo Metro Ginza Line subway.

Ueno

Try the hanami tradition of admiring flowers as you walk past cherry blossoms and delve into the history of this area through its museums and ornate temples.

Best time to go to Tokyo

The best time to visit Tokyo is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. August is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.

The nearest major airports for your trip to Tokyo

Traveling to Tokyo is convenient with its major airports. Haneda Airport (HND) is located 14.5km from central Tokyo, with excellent hotel options such as The Prince Park Tower Tokyo and Grand Hyatt Tokyo, both 12.9km away. The Capitol Hotel Tokyu is also nearby at 14.5km. Narita International Airport (NRT), situated 57.9km away, offers hotels like Hotel Nikko Narita and ANA Crowne Plaza Narita, both within 1.6km. For those considering Ibaraki Airport (IBR), located 80.5km from Tokyo, you can find Mito Plaza Hotel and Hotel Route Inn Ishioka, offering comfortable stays within 19.3km. What's the seasonal weather like in Tokyo?
The hottest months are usually August and July with an average temp of 77°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 46°F. The rainiest months in Tokyo are October, September, June, and July, with each month seeing an average of 7 inches of rainfall.
